Frederick K. Swartz Business Ledger

 Collection — Box Ledger
Identifier: 003-MS 85
Scope and Contents

Business ledger containing rental records for horses, wagons, carriages and sleighs as well as notes describing Swartz's contract work transporting people to the Harrisburg Poor House. Includes the names and professions of customers, equipment rented, and cost of rental.

Dates: 1851-1870

Jacob Weaver Account Ledger and Daybook

 Collection
Identifier: 003-MS 123
Scope and Contents Account ledger and daybook containing the business records of Jacob Weaver, a tailor and barber from Washington Square, Pa. The ledger includes a list of clothing manufactured or repaired by Weaver, the price of the clothing, and the names of those purchasing the clothes. Also includes a record of uniforms made for soldiers during the American Civil War, a list of names of those who received haircuts and shaves, and an index to the names included in the volume. John Coy Business Ledger

 Collection — Box Ledger
Identifier: MS-86
Scope and Contents

Business ledger providing the daily boarding, storage and rental records for horses, wagons, and carriages from the livery stable operated by John Coy of Harrisburg, Pa. Includes the names of those boarding and renting animals and equipment plus the cost of services rendered.

Dates: 1833-1835
